Fact Check: Shell Denies Explosive Merger Talks with BP

What We Know

Recently, reports surfaced claiming that Shell was in early discussions to acquire BP, as indicated by an article from the Wall Street Journal. However, Shell has publicly denied these claims. According to a statement from Shell, "no talks are taking place" regarding a potential takeover of BP, which they labeled as "market speculation" (Reuters, The Guardian).

The Wall Street Journal's report suggested that the discussions could lead to a significant merger, potentially valued at around £60 billion, which would create one of the largest oil companies in the world (WSJ). Despite this, Shell's firm denial indicates that no formal negotiations are occurring at this time.

Analysis

The reliability of the sources reporting on this matter varies. The Wall Street Journal is generally considered a reputable publication, especially in financial and business reporting. However, the article cited unnamed sources, which can sometimes lead to speculation rather than confirmed facts (WSJ).

On the other hand, Shell's response comes directly from the company, making it a primary source of information regarding its own corporate actions. The clarity of Shell's statement, which explicitly denies any ongoing discussions, adds weight to its credibility (Reuters).

Additionally, the coverage from Reuters and The Guardian corroborates Shell's denial, further supporting the assertion that the initial reports were unfounded. Both outlets are known for their journalistic standards and provide a balanced view by reporting both the claims and the company's rebuttal (Reuters, The Guardian).

Conclusion

Verdict: True. Shell has indeed denied any ongoing talks regarding a merger with BP. The company's clear and direct statement, alongside corroborating reports from reputable news sources, confirms that the claims of explosive merger talks are unfounded at this time.
